**Leadership Review Briefing — Larkspur Line Pricing**

Quick one for the board: the Larkspur range is holding margin, but mid-tier bundles are getting undercut by Venholt's new entrants. We propose a modest reprice on the two flagship SKUs and a trial discount in the Calder region. Full rationale sits in the note below.

board note of yaguf-fawif: Headcount on the Zorix team goes from 7 to 80 by the end of October. Gross margin on Zorix came in at 10 percent against a plan of 20 percent.

## Configuration

The Kerrowmap driver-assignment heuristic weighs proximity, shift remaining, and historical acceptance rate. Tune these via ASSIGN_WEIGHT_DIST, ASSIGN_WEIGHT_SHIFT, and ASSIGN_WEIGHT_ACCEPT; they must sum to 1.0 or the service refuses to start. Release managers should verify weights match the approved rollout sheet before tagging. The heuristic service authenticates to the dispatch bus with a credential set on the next line.

secret setting of tajog-bafog: RELAY_SECRET13=8f6af7680fb2b

**Audit-Log Viewer (Trailglass) — On-Call Notes**

Trailglass reads from the append-only event store; it never mutates records. If entries appear missing, check the ingest lag panel before escalating — delays up to ten minutes are normal after bulk imports. Access requests require approver sign-off. For access issues or data discrepancies, reach the records team below.

pager mailbox: druwyn@norvaio.corp